One of the first aspects I focus on is the active ingredient. This is crucial because different substances have varying modes of action against fleas. For instance, products containing imidacloprid or fipronil are known for their effectiveness in eliminating adult fleas, while methoprene acts as an insect growth regulator, preventing larvae from maturing. By opting for a formula that combines these ingredients, I can target fleas at multiple life stages, ensuring a more comprehensive approach.

Steps for Optimal Application

Here is my step-by-step guide for applying insecticides effectively:

  1. Choose the Right Product: I make sure to select an insecticide specifically formulated for fleas. This helps ensure that the active ingredients are effective at targeting these pests.
  2. Read the Instructions: I carefully read the label for dosage and application methods. Each product may have unique requirements that I need to follow closely.
  3. Prepare the Lawn: Before application, I mow the grass to a shorter height. This helps the insecticide reach the soil more effectively. I also water the lawn lightly, as moist soil can enhance the absorption of the treatment.
  4. Apply Evenly: Using a spreader or sprayer, I apply the insecticide evenly across the lawn. I ensure that I cover all areas, including the borders and any spots where my pets frequent.
  5. Water Post-Application: After allowing the product to sit for the recommended time, I give my lawn a good watering. This helps activate the insecticide and allows it to penetrate deeper into the soil.

Before applying any insecticide, it’s important to read the label carefully for specific safety instructions. Additionally, understanding the active ingredients will help you choose a product that is both effective against fleas and safe for your family. Here are some key safety tips to keep in mind:

  • Keep pets and children indoors: Always ensure that pets and children are kept indoors during and immediately after application. Foll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for how long to avoid the treated area.
  • Choose pet-safe products: Look for insecticides labeled as safe for use around pets and children. Organic or natural options may be a safer choice.
  • Wear protective gear: When applying insecticides, wear gloves, a mask, and long sleeves to minimize skin contact and inhalation of chemicals.
  • Follow application instructions: Adhere strictly to the instructions on the label regarding dosage and frequency of application to avoid overexposure.
  • Store products safely: Keep all insecticides out of reach of children and pets. Store them in a secure location, preferably in their original containers.

FAQ:

What is the best lawn insecticide for fleas?

The best lawn insecticide for fleas is often considered to be those containing active ingredients like bifenthrin, permethrin, or imidacloprid, as they are effective in killing fleas on contact and preventing future infestations.

How do I apply insecticide to my lawn for flea control?

To apply insecticide for flea control, follow the manufacturer’s instructions on the product label. Generally, you’ll want to evenly distribute the insecticide over the affected areas using a sprayer or spreader, ensuring to cover areas where pets frequent.

Are there any natural alternatives to synthetic insecticides for fleas?

Yes, natural alternatives to synthetic insecticides for fleas include diatomaceous earth, nematodes, and essential oils like cedarwood or lavender. These can help repel or kill fleas without harmful chemicals.

How often should I treat my lawn for fleas?

It is generally recommended to treat your lawn for fleas every 4-6 weeks during peak flea season, especially if you live in a warm, humid area where fleas thrive.

Can I use lawn insecticides if I have pets or children?

While many lawn insecticides are safe for use around pets and children, it’s crucial to read the product labels carefully. Always keep pets and children off treated areas until the insecticide has dried or as recommended by the manufacturer.
